Help at Home Acquires Home Care Now of Central Florida
In a significant move to enhance its influence in the home care sector, Help at Home has announced its acquisition of Home Care Now, a company based in Central Florida. This strategic decision not only strengthens Help at Home’s operational presence in the state but also underscores its commitment to providing essential home care services to Florida's vulnerable populations. As the country’s foremost provider of innovative and relationship-driven personal care, Help at Home aims to ensure that residents can age in place comfortably and safely in their own homes.
A Growing Need for Home Care Services
Currently, in Florida, over 5 million individuals rely on home care services, highlighting the increasing demand for reliable in-home care. Help at Home’s latest acquisition allows the company to serve an even wider clientele across every county in Florida. Glen Golemi, the Regional Leader for Help at Home in Florida, expressed enthusiasm for the integration of Home Care Now’s teams and caregivers, stating: “We welcome Home Care Now of Central Florida teams, caregivers, payers, and partners to Help at Home.” With a robust annual care service of 1.5 million hours, the company is equipped to cater to a growing number of individuals requiring assistance.

Transitioning the Brand
As part of the acquisition, the Home Care Now brand will eventually be rebranded under the Help at Home umbrella, although it will maintain its operations in Tampa and Clearwater for the time being. This transition reflects a significant step in Help at Home’s growth strategy, enhancing its capacity to provide care solutions tailored to each client's needs.
Help at Home stands as a testament to the evolution of home care services in America. With over 200 branches across 11 states, the company has successfully provided in-home personal care to 70,000 clients supported by a dedicated workforce of 60,000 trained caregivers. Since its inception in 1975 in Chicago, Help at Home has dedicated itself to improving the lives of those most in need, establishing a legacy built on compassion and quality service.
